Studying Media and Visual Arts in Turkey: An Opportunity for International Students

Istanbul Medipol University's Media and Visual Arts undergraduate program offers international students an innovative education at the intersection of modern media and art. This program aims to provide theoretical knowledge and practical skills across a wide range of fields such as digital media, film, television, graphic design, and new media arts. Istanbul's rich cultural and artistic environment offers a unique learning and experience-gaining setting for students. The program, designed specifically for international students with English as the medium of instruction, provides a global perspective and makes graduates competitive in the international arena.

Media and Visual Arts Curriculum and Academic Content

The curriculum of the Media and Visual Arts program is continuously updated to meet current industry needs. Students can focus on their own interests through elective courses, in addition to core subjects such as filmmaking, photography, animation, digital marketing, visual communication design, media theories, and art history. The program utilizes studio courses, workshops, and project-based learning methods to help students develop their creativity, enhance critical thinking skills, and strengthen their technical capabilities. Education provided by experienced academics and industry professionals offers students real-world experiences.

Post-Graduation Career Opportunities and Taking Your Place in the Global Media Industry

Graduates of the Media and Visual Arts program have a wide range of career options. They can work in positions such as film director, producer, screenwriter, editor, cinematographer, photographer, graphic designer, animator, digital media specialist, advertiser, public relations specialist, art director, and media consultant. The program equips students with the necessary knowledge and skills to succeed not only in Turkey but also in the international media and art sector. Thanks to internship opportunities and strong connections with the industry, graduates can easily adapt to professional life and have the chance to realize their own creative projects.

The program is conducted entirely in English. Therefore, applicants must achieve a sufficient score from an internationally recognized English language proficiency exam such as TOEFL (IBT 75) or IELTS (6.0). For students who do not meet the required score, an English preparatory education is available within the university.

After receiving your acceptance letter from the university, you need to apply for a student visa at the Turkish Embassy or Consulate in your country. Required documents generally include the acceptance letter, passport, visa application form, biometric photo, and proof of financial solvency. You can obtain detailed information about the process from the relevant Turkish representative office.
